Output 84651febc366322eae11f625d1a8c4c9946ac26dca2e9b1ff59fa81ccb93e85c:4

value
1209953046
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b98caa57c90ffa7c09b86f10492b032706b609f OP_EQUAL
address
3PAjkmaw3vzWX8wZ2pjKd78LtfvJpvdEHe
transaction
84651febc366322eae11f625d1a8c4c9946ac26dca2e9b1ff59fa81ccb93e85c
spent
true